1969 Buick Riviera Gs 2-door Hardtop 455ci Resto-mod on 2040-cars

Year:1969 Mileage:0

This is a spectacular and incomparable resto-mod version of a rare classic that offers a unique blend of luxury and exhilarating performance.  It is a 2 owner car that was purchased in 1993 from the original owner, who gave it only the best of care and kept meticulous records throughout his ownership (Protect-O-Plate, window sticker and dealer invoice come with car).  It is equipped with every available option except cruise control, and even has a specially ordered front bench seat and cornering lights.  Of the 50,000 Rivieras made in 1969, only about 10%, or 5,000, were ordered with the GS option, which included a heavy duty suspension, performance axle (3.42) and posi-traction.  The original 430ci engine has been replaced with a 455ci Buick engine that produces 507HP/540 ft-lbs of torque and runs on 93 octane gas.

Modifications to the engine include the following:

·         Block bored .030 over to 462ci (10.5:1 compression)

·         Stage II aluminum heads (ported & polished)

·         850 CFM Quik Fuel carb revamped by Gary Williams

·         TA 290H performance cam (.508”/.525” lift & .238/.290 duration)

·         TA 3000 stall converter

·         TA roller rockers

·         Ceramic-coated headers

Additional performance/modifications & enhancements:

·         B Cool aluminum radiator w/ twin electric fans

·         2-1/2” dual exhaust with Magnaflow mufflers

·         Factory 400 turbo transmission w/ shift kit

·         Front disc brakes w/ electric booster

·         Air Ride Technologies air ride suspension

·         Retractable headlights operated by electric linear motors

·         Keyless entry & alarm system

·         “Star Wars” air cleaner included ($1000  value)

Body/Paint/Interior/Wheels/Tires:

·         The rust-free and laser-straight body is finished in PPG “Cool Vanilla.”  The top material is BMW convertible canvas, which provides both an elegant and decidedly refined appearance.

·         Excellent stainless, chrome & glass

·         Shaved door handles/locks

·         Custom interior by “Stitches”

·         “MOZ” 3-piece wheels (20”F/22”R)

·         Nitto tires

No expense was spared in the building and restoration of this magnificent car.  It has won many awards at Goodguys events in Kansas City, Des Moines, and Charlotte.  It has also received awards at Kansas City World of Wheels and Devlin-Starbird in Witchita.

GM SUV window switch recall urges owners to park vehicles outside

Thu, 07 Aug 2014

It's not unusual for there to be a lag between an automaker announcing a recall and the official documentation showing up on the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ration website. So it's no surprise that a recent GM campaign took about a month to appear in its official capacity. However, there appears to be some big differences between the two reports with potential safety implications.
In late June, GM announced that it needed to recall 181,984 examples of the Chevrolet Trailblazer, Buick Rainier, GMC Envoy, Isuzu Ascender and Saab 9-7x from the 2005-2007 model years, plus the 2006 Chevy Trailblazer EXT and 2006 GMC Envoy XL. The new documents paint a slightly different picture with 184,611 needing repaired and different model years listed.
The reason for the fix is still the same, though. It's possible for fluid to contact the master power window switch module in the driver's door, which can corrode the part. Eventually this could cause a short circuit, leaving the buttons inoperable and potentially leading to a fire. But the new NHTSA documents add an important note: "A fire could occur even while the vehicle is not in use. As a precaution, owners are advised to park outside until the remedy has been made."

GM recalling 1.5M cars in China for faulty bracket

Fri, 27 Dec 2013

General Motors and its Chinese partners have announced their second recall in the People's Republic this year, following a 2,653-unit recall of the Cadillac SRX earlier this year. This latest recall affects nearly 1.5 million cars built between 2006 and 2012. It's not explicitly stated, but as there's no movement from the US NHTSA, we suspect that the cars in question were all Chinese-built rather than imports.
The vast majority of the affected vehicles are Buick Excelles (pictured), with 1.2 million units being recalled over a faulty bracket that's meant to secure the fuel pump. The Excelles in question were built between 2006 and 2012, while an additional 250,000 Chevrolet Sail superminis, built between April 2009 and October 2011, are being recalled for a similar reason.
According to the PRC's Administration for Quality Supervision, Inspection and Quarantine, the faulty bracket could crack and potentially cause a fuel leak.

Opel Insignia OPC Sports Tourer shows its fresh face ahead of Frankfurt debut

Thu, 22 Aug 2013

Drive down the Autobahn and there's any number of vehicles likely to pass you, and most of them are produced locally. But if you're wondering how that Opel left you in its dust, look closely (and quickly) enough and you might make out the letters OPC on the back.
They stand for Opel Performance Center (the German counterpart to Vauxhall's VXR line) and they adorn performance versions of the Corsa, Astra and Insignia. The latter is undergoing a bit of a refresh and is expected to debut at the Frankfurt Motor Show in a couple of weeks, but you don't have to wait that long as our intrepid spy photographers have caught it in the flesh outside an Opel facility in Germany.
Spied here completely undisguised in Sports Tourer (read: wagon) form, the Insignia has had a few nips and tucks performed, but we'll be more intrigued to see what it's got under the hood. The current model packs a 2.8-liter twin-turbo V6 driving 325 horsepower to all four wheels, but rumors suggest that the OPC (yeah you know me!) could have as much as 400 hp up its sleeve. That would make this one heck of a sleeper - especially in wagon form - and only make us pine for a more potent version of its twin Buick Regal to roam our highways, too.
